General description: The spPlate files contain the combined spectra for all exposures of a given plate. There are typically three 900s exposures which may have been taken in a single night, or over multiple nights. This page is an updated summary of the SDSS2 spPlate data model.
Naming convention: spPlate-pppp-mmmmm.fits, where pppp is a 4-digit plate number, and mmmmm is a 5-digit MJD.
Approximate size: 60 Mbytes.
File type: FITS
Read by products: spreduce1d, sspp
Written by products: spcombine
HDU0 | NPIX x 640 float image | Flux in units of 10^-17^ erg/s/cm^2^/Ang |
HDU1 | NPIX x 640 float image | Inverse variance (1/sigma^2^) for HDU 0 |
HDU2 | NPIX x 640 32-bit int image | AND mask |
HDU3 | NPIX x 640 32-bit int image | OR mask |
HDU4 | NPIX x 640 float image | Wavelength dispersion in pixels |
HDU5 fields | binary table | Plug-map structure from plPlugMapM file |
HDU6 | NPIX x 640 float image | Average sky flux in units of 10^-17^ erg/s/cm^2^/Ang |
Note: Additional HDUs may be present for engineering purposes, but are not supported and are subject to change. Users should refrain from using HDUs not listed here.
